Análisis de fecha de JavaScript ()
Ejemplo 1
let ms = Date.parse("March 21, 2012");
Definición y uso
parse()
analiza una cadena de fecha y devuelve la diferencia horaria desde el 1 de enero de 1970.
parse()
devuelve la diferencia horaria en milisegundos.
Ejemplo 2
Calcule el número de años entre el 1 de enero de 1970 y el 21 de marzo de 2012:
// Calculate milliseconds in a year
const minute = 1000 * 60;
const hour = minute * 60;
const day = hour * 24;
const year = day * 365;
// Compute years
const d = Date.parse("March 21, 2012");
let years = Math.round(d / year);
Compatibilidad con navegador
parse()
es una característica de ECMAScript1 (ES1).
ES1 (JavaScript 1997) es totalmente compatible con todos los navegadores:
Chrome | IE | Edge | Firefox | Safari | Opera |
Yes | Yes | Yes | Yes | Yes | Yes |
Sintaxis
Date.parse(datestring)
Parámetros
datestring | Required. A string representing a date. |
Valor devuelto
Un número. Milisegundos desde el 1 de enero de 1970 00:00:00 UTC. |